Sibley County's estimated 2026 population is 15,422 with a growth rate of 0.43% in the past year according to the most recent United States census data. Sibley County is the 54th largest county in Minnesota. The 2010 population was 15,257 and has seen a growth of 1.08% since that time.

The racial composition of Sibley County includes 87.9% White, 3.05% other race, and smaller percentages for Black or African American, Asian, Native American,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ander and multiracial populations.
Race | Population | Percentage (of total) |
|---|---|---|
| White | 13,189 | 87.9% |
| Two or more races | 1,075 | 7.16% |
| Other race | 458 | 3.05% |
| Black or African American | 179 | 1.19% |
| Asian | 61 | 0.41% |
| Native American | 33 | 0.22% |
|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 10 | 0.07% |
Sibley County's average per capita income is $51,153. Household income levels show a median of $77,634. The poverty rate stands at 9.01%.
